[Plant antigens with immunological properties. II. Further studies of the chemical characteristics and immunological properties of a grass pollen extract].

作者信息

Ravagnan G, Ravagnan L, Caliò Villani N, Santucci L

出版信息

Ann Sclavo. 1976 Jan-Feb;18(1):38-43.

PMID:973743
Abstract

This second study carried out on an extract of two grass pollens (Poa pratensis and Phleum pratense) demonstrated the presence of N-acetilglucosamine and sialic acid in the extract (RFEX). Moreover the extract has confirmed its characteristics biologic activity i.e. the inhibition of the phenomenon of immune hemolysis with a different technique too, even having the antibodies of the treated animals the complement fixing activity. No appreciable changes of the immunoelectrophoresis pattern in the serum of the immunized mice have been noticed.
